Make sure oco web daemon has read access to the file. I had the need to connect to a oracle database from a php script in one of my recent projects, the following is what i did to enable oracle connectivity in xampp for windows. This means that it will work only on systems that have an oracle package that includes the oracle call interface oci libraries. Instant client downloads for microsoft windows x64 64bit see the instant client home page for more information about instant client the installation instructions are at the foot of the page oracle clientto oracle database version interoperability is detailed in doc id 207303. These components are supplied by oracle corporation and are part of oracle version 7. Mar 11, 2020 according to oracle, if your jdbc client and oracle database server are running on the same machine, you should use the oci driver because it is much faster than the thin driver the oci driver can use inter process communication ipc, whereas the thin driver can use only network connection. Download dll, ocx and vxd files for windows for free. Jan 19, 2016 download jdbc driver library for oracle. It can work using oracle call interface oci or sqlnet directly. It can be an easy connect string, or a connect name from the tnsnames.
According to oracle, if your jdbc client and oracle database server are running on the same machine, you should use the oci driver because it is much faster than the thin driver the oci driver can use inter process communication ipc, whereas the thin driver can use only network connection for example, if you want to connect user tiger with password scott to an. Oracle jdbc driver and url information for thin and oci. Hi, thanks for that reference, i cannot see the oracle 11g odbc drivers from here. Returns a connection identifier needed for most other oci8 operations. Click on test connection which also saves the data server. The connection information is likely to be well known for established oracle databases. Oci has better support for advanced data types including xml. Mar 04, 2020 laraveloci8 is an oracle database driver package for laravel. Oracle sql developer 4 and the oracle client thatjeffsmith. This website makes no representation or warranty of any kind, either expressed or implied, as to the accuracy, completeness ownership or reliability of the.
In order to use the oracle oci drivers, a oracle client installation is usually required on your machine. The program is written in c using oci and supports array fetching, which means good performance. Qt how use oci driver without installing oracle client. The oci connection pooling feature is an oracledesigned extension. For the jdbc oci driver, in addition to the three oci shared libraries, you must also download oci jdbc library for example libocijdbc12. These components are supplied by oracle corporation and are part of oracle. Place all libraries in the instant client directory. The oci connection pooling feature is an oracle designed extension. This library is part of the client software installed with the database. Oracle jdbc driver and url information for thin and oci drivers. The installation wizard creates an oracle jdbc provider that uses the oracle 10g jdbc driver ojdbc14. The oracle odbc driver translates odbc sql syntax into syntax that can be. However, you might want to use the oracle 11g jdbc driver ojdbc5. The oracletm client and networking components were not found.
Dll unless you are oracle business partner or however is it called these days. Oracle call interface oci is the comprehensive, high performance, native c language interface to oracle database for custom or packaged applications. Standard edition, standard edition one, and enterprise edition. Mar 19, 2020 alteryx recommends using the 11g or newer driver. Instant client downloads for microsoft windows 32bit. Installing oracle database, php, and apache on microsoft. Laraveloci8 is an oracle database driver package for laravel. Give the new data source name, select tns service name and user id. Jan 06, 2014 oci has better support for advanced data types including xml. Connecting oracle data integrator studio to the autonomous.
This repair tool is designed to diagnose your windows pc problems and repair them quickly. How to install oracle odbc driver on windows 10 manjaro. Each call on a logical connection is routed on to the physical connection that is available at the given. Generally we recommend the oracle thin driver over the oci driver since it works on any platform that supports java. Epm downloading and installing oracle 11g client and. If using the oci drivers, you must supply the jar or zip file located in the oracle client directory path to connect to the database. There are very few features that are available in the oci driver and not in the thin driver see the documentation. The thick, oci, driver is the more scalable of the two. It scans your pc, identifies the problem areas and fixes them completely. Jdbcoracle connectivity issue with oci8 drive using. Oracle database programming interface for c odpic is a new open source library of c code that simplifies the use of common oci features for oracle database drivers and user applications.
To use the oci driver, you must also install the oracle database instant client, because it contains all the libraries required for the oci driver to communicate with the database. If using the oci drivers, you must supply the jar or zip file located in the oracle client directory path to. Unless youre using some of these, steve, id suggest using the jdbc thin driver. Qt compiled oracle oci driver this article is an english version of an article which is originally in the chinese language on and is provided for information purposes only. Aug 31, 2010 php has got the oci8 extension, which provides oracle connectivity to php application, and oci8 uses oracle instant client package to get oracle specific functions. The oracle odbc driver uses the oracle call interface oci client and server software to submit requests to and receive responses from the data source. The selection of which driver to use depends on the interface. Oracle provides drivers that enable users to make jdbc connections to oracle databases. The jdbc oci driver uses the oci libraries, centry points, oracle net, core libraries, and other necessary files on the client computer where it is installed. Prior to version 4, you would tell sql developer to use the ocithick driver by the way, oci stands for oracle client interface. For windows 10 compatibility, oracle 12c or higher will need to be installed.
See the instant client home page for more information about instant client the installation instructions are at the foot of the page clientserver version interoperability is detailed in doc id 207303. If using 32 bit php, youll need use the 32 bit windows oracle instant client. Click test connection to validate the connection to the oracle database server. Epm downloading and installing oracle 11g client and odbc. Ocilib is an open source and cross platform oracle driver that delivers efficient access to oracle databases. This jdbc driver can be used for connecting to both oracle 10g and oracle 11g. The two most common methods of connecting to oracle databases via jdbc are the oracle thin jdbc driver and the oracle oci jdbc driver. Scroll down the to list of platforms and click the see all link next to your operating system. Myoradump is a program that will export oracle data stored in most of the basic oracle types as a text file that can for example be used for import into other databases, for example mariadb and mysql. You will find user friendly and updated documentation here. The oci driver needs to use oracle database client libraries. The oracle tm client and networking components were not found.
Setting up a file dsn or user dsn or system dsn using microsoft odbc for oracle driver. Oracle connection uses the oracle call interface oci library to connect to the oracle database. Fast connection failover fcf test client using 11g jdbc driver and 11g rac cluster id 566573. The oci drivers are usually contained in the classes12. How to install oracle odbc driver on windows 10 manjaro dot. Features specific to jdbc oci driver oracle help center. Jun 14, 2010 they may appear in the apache or php log. Laraveloci8 is an extension of illuminatedatabase that uses oci8 extension to communicate with oracle.
The oracle thin driver requires no software other than the driver jar file. Oracle oledb is not supported in the indatabase tools. Php has got the oci8 extension, which provides oracle connectivity to php application, and oci8 uses oracle instant client package to get oracle specific functions. Remove the semicolon from the beginning of the line. Instant client for linux on power big endian 32bit instant client for linux on power big endian 64bit instant client for linux on power little endian 64bit instant client for zlinux 31bit instant client for zlinux 64bit instant client for linux itanium. In addition blob, clob, nclob as well as raw, long and long raw is. The connection pooling provided by the jdbc oci driver enables applications to have multiple logical connections, all of which are using a small set of physical connections. See connection handling for general information on connection management and connection pooling from php 5. Using php oci8 with 32bit php on windows 64bit oracle. However you might not always want to use this thin driver, but instead want to use the thick oci type 2 driver.
Update ocilib full name from ocilib c wrapper for oracle oci to ocilib c driver for oracle. So, if youre onboard with the idea of connecting up your oracle client with sql developer, lets talk about how to get that going. Jun 21, 2011 oracle data integrator 11g comes out of the box with a whole bunch of jdbc drivers. How to implement connect failover using jdbc thin id 2412. Instant client for microsoft windows x64 64bit oracle. There users have to download oci libs manually and have all ale oracle specific code is put into separate plugin. Oracle net services communications protocol is used for communications between the oci client and the oracle server.
Oracle database 11g release 2 jdbc driver downloads. For example, applications using oracle call interface 19 can connect to oracle database 11. There is something wrong with your system please check that path includes the directory with oracle instant client libraries. If you already have a commercial license, you should download your software from the oracle software delivery cloud, which is specifically designed for customer fulfillment. Oracle data integrator 11g comes out of the box with a whole bunch of jdbc drivers. Odpic is a thin layer on top of oci and requires oracle client libraries. Obiee 10g11g oracle call interface oci configuration gerardnico the default port is this question appears to be offtopic. Instant client downloads for microsoft windows 32bit download package. Oracle jdbc includes two drivers that can be used to connect java programs to the oracle database.
307 1256 149 286 757 105 715 1342 1 378 1034 951 876 1179 951 552 290 134 542 518 758 851 1347 1050 994 127 1403 450 982